Chapter 1 ~Face To Face With The Purple Eyed Devil~

~TRUDITH ARCHER~

I stood up from my bed. I had just been interrupted from my lovely nap by the loud noise I was hearing downstairs. I didn't know what was going on, but I wanted to find out. I stepped out of my room to see people running, the smell of smoke wafted through the air, my vision filled with some parts of the house on fire.

"Auntie, what's going on?" I asked a random older pack member who was running in the opposite direction.

"The house is under attack. True, try to save yourself" she said before sprinting off.

I didn't like what I was hearing, but I knew I was scared and needed my father. I rushed to his office, but I couldn't find him there. My worry about him doubled.

I barged into his bedroom, but he wasn't there either. I could feel my heart pounding furiously in my chest, I was worried sick and trying my best to think positively.

I closed the door of his bedroom and thought hard about where my father could possibly be, hoping he wasn't in any form of danger.

On finding out that a major part of the commotion was coming from the main living room, I ran down there even though I was scared to death. I saw my father on the ground with some people around him. He was on his knees shaking with fear. I had never known my fearless and brave father to fear anything, but today I saw him quake at the sight of a young boy with a gun in his hands. A gun that was pointed at my father's temple.

My father felt my presence and turned to look at me. I saw regret and anger in his eyes. He looked like he was scared more for me than himself. He wanted to protect me and I understood that. I couldn't do anything to save him... I mean, what could a 14-year-old kid do to save anyone?

"Run!!!" He yelled at him, his voice cracking.

"Dad, no " I don't want to leave you" I said, making the boy snap his head towards me. I was shocked by his handsomeness. He looked like God and his eyes... his eyes stood out so much. They weren't the regular orbs you would see on the street, they were purple and filled with a sense of revenge, hatred, anger and sadness all in one. His eyes spoke volumes about how much he wanted to kill me at that moment.

"Get her", his baritone voice broke me from my wandering thoughts, dragging me back to reality and making me remember the situation I was stuck in.

I stared at my father one more time and at his nod, I sped through the backdoor. I wanted to escape as fast as I could. I hadn't learned how to transform, so I couldn't change into my wolf form for an easier escape. My pursuers had already transformed into their wolf forms and charged hard at me. I knew that if they got their hands on me, they would tear me into pieces and I would die.

I didn't want to disappoint my father or make his sacrifice go to waste, so I needed to survive. I also prayed to the moon goddess, hoping for a way out for me and my family.

I managed to lose them when I entered the deeper part of the woods. I hid in the fauna for several days, hiding my scent by washing in the stagnant creek or applying sharp-scented berries and plants, nearly dying from hunger and dehydration. I needed food. Even just water would be good enough because my throat felt like it was about to collapse. The last thing I thought of before the darkness took me was my father.

~SIX YEARS LATER~

I walked into the club using the secret password, and it was buzzing with customers. I couldn't help the grin that came to my face because I knew it meant 'LOTS OF MONEY'.

I went straight to the dresser room and changed into my attire, putting on my mask. Many men were ready to spend their money tonight, and I had no problem with that. I was going to dance to my fullest today.

I stepped on the stage and I started hearing roars and howls of hungry men ready to feast their eyes.

"Yay Dith" they all yelled my stage name. I was the most requested stripper in this club and everyone waited for the day I came out to dance.

I placed my hands on the pole, loving the colorful led light on my skin when SAVAGE by Meghan Thee stallion started playing in the background. I went down on the pole and started dancing. They all roared and yelled, making me smile.

. . . . . . .

I was done dancing. I had just come down from the stage and was heading to the dresser room when I bumped into Loretta. Shit! I had wanted to leave as soon as possible.

"Hey True" she smiled. "You made a lot of money today", she congratulated.

"As usual... I'll be heading to your office later to get the payment from last time and today". I really needed the money this time.

"About that, I'm planning to double the money by three if you do this private section," she said with a pleading look on her face. I didn't like what she was saying, not in the slightest. She knew I didn't do private sections because a lot of bad things could happen there, and I've seen many of my colleagues die from the wrong clients.

"But Retta, I was just getting ready to leave, and I didn't really have time for this," I explained, hoping she would let me go.

"I've never asked you to do this before, so please just help me. They are my biggest helpers and I don't want to lose them." I really didn't want to do this, but I knew how much help Loretta had done in my life. She saved me, and now it was time for me to do something for her too.

.....

I walked into the room and the first thing I felt was chills. The room was so cold from the intimidating men surrounding the environment. I wanted to run back and act like I was never there, but they noticed me.

"Hey, you must be her" a guy walked over to my side, sniffing my hair. I couldn't take my eyes away from the scar on his forehead leading to his chest. It looked painful and he looked brutal.

I was scared of him and I hated the way he groped me. He was treating me like I was his prostitute and he had this entitlement towards my body. I didn't like it, so I tried pushing him away, but he was too strong to budge. The rest of the men didn't seem to give a damn about how he was assaulting me, and it felt like I was alone here. I did what I could to protect myself. I smacked his face hard, making him move back.

The men who didn't seem to give a damn about my existence suddenly noticed that I was here and growled at me. They hated that I hit one of their men, but I didn't regret it.

I turned to leave when I heard...

"And where the hell do you think you're going?" It was the deepest voice I had ever heard and, strangely enough, it felt familiar.

I turned and I met those rare purple orbs. The blood drained from my face. Could he be the same person from six years ago? Did I just walk into hell ?
